Louisiana officials react to US Supreme Court ruling on social media misinformation suit
Louisiana Attorney General Liz Murrill called a Supreme Court ruling "disappointing" after the justices ruled in favor of the Biden administration over how far the federal government can fight misinformation on social media.
DHS: Migrant encounters down 40% since new asylum rules took effect
Border Patrol agents have seen a 40% drop in migrant encounters on the Southwest border in the past three weeks since President Biden issued new asylum orders, the Department of Homeland Security said Wednesday.
